Hi,
I am new to this forum but i already took a lot of useful help and information about my crossfire. BIG THANKS TO ALL OF YOU.
This car was parked over 3 years because of a tranny issue with the previous owner. It was a good deal to buy it as project since most the parts were Mercedes and i have mercedes cars over the years and have some experience to deal with them. The car was not maintained well so i change most of the parts like engine and tranny mounts, new radiator, brake pads, fuel pump, spark plug, stabilizer link , new tires and a used tranny. I thought i will fix the car then sell it but i never expect how fun to drive this car around. Sorry if my english is not perfect since it is my second language.
